Venman Bushland National Park forms part of the Koala Bushland Coordinated Conservation Area. Today we will follow the 7.5km Venman trail clock-wise through Eucalypt forest on well-marked trails. It is undulating but no serious hills, with one hill just enough to get you puffing. There are a couple of creek crossings with permanently placed stepping stones. You may be lucky enough to see koalas and wallabies plus a variety of birdlife.
